About 4-chloro-6-phenylmethoxyquinoline
4-chloro-6-phenylmethoxyquinoline (PubChem CID 23078431) has the molecular formula C16H12ClNO
and a molecular weight of 269.73 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-chloro-6-phenylmethoxyquinoline.
